SEO(搜索引擎优化)是现代互联网营销中不可或缺的一个环节,目的是提高网站在搜索引擎中的排名,增加网站流量。在众多SEO从业者和网站运营者中,常常会出现一个疑问:做SEO工作,究竟需要学代码吗?
要回答这个问题,首先我们需要明确SEO的核心目标:提高网站在搜索引擎中的可见性,进而吸引更多的潜在用户。很多人认为SEO工作只是单纯的关键词研究、内容优化和外部链接建设等,但实际上,SEO不仅仅是“内容为王”,还与技术密切相关。
SEO的工作可以大致分为两类:技术性SEO和内容性SEO。技术性SEO更多的是关注网站的结构、速度、响应性等技术性问题,而内容性SEO则涉及到关键词的选择、页面内容的优化等。
对于技术性SEO,学会一定的编程语言、了解网站架构和前端开发技术是非常有帮助的。比如,了解HTML、CSS和JavaScript等前端技术,可以帮助你更好地优化网页的加载速度、调整页面结构、改善用户体验等。
网站的结构直接影响搜索引擎对网站的抓取和索引。如果你能够理解代码并知道如何优化网站的结构,那么你就能够让搜索引擎更容易地抓取你的网站,从而提升排名。
比如,HTML代码中的标签、<meta>标签、以及页面的URL结构等,都需要精心设计。这些元素对搜索引擎的排名有着直接的影响。学习基础的HTML可以帮助你更好地理解这些标签的作用,确保每个页面都经过合理的SEO设置。</p><h3>网页加载速度</h3><p>网页加载速度是一个非常重要的SEO排名因素。Google明确表示,页面加载速度是影响用户体验的重要因素,而搜索引擎也会依据用户体验来排名。如果你了解一些前端开发技术,如JavaScript优化、图片压缩、CSS优化等,便能更有效地提高网页的加载速度。</p><h3>2.内容性SEO与代码的关系</h3><p>与技术性SEO相比,内容性SEO的工作更侧重于对网页内容的优化。即便是在内容性SEO中,编程知识也会有所帮助。例如,在创建一个博客文章时,如果你能使用适当的HTML标签(如<h1>、<h2>等)来结构化内容,搜索引擎会更容易理解文章的层次与主题,从而有利于排名。</p><p>SEO的另一项重要工作是关键词研究。虽然这项工作通常不需要编程知识,但当你通过编程构建一个爬虫抓取工具时,能够自动化地获取大量关键词数据和竞争对手的关键词排名,这对于提升SEO效果是非常有帮助的。</p><h3>3.做SEO不必精通代码,但懂一些会更有优势</h3><p>很多SEO从业者
并不需要精通编程语言,尤其是对于那些专注于内容创作和市场推广的人员来说。了解一定的编程知识,尤其是HTML、CSS和JavaScript等基础知识,对于提升SEO效率和精准度无疑会有很大的帮助。</p><p>对于初学者来说,学习代码不需要从复杂的编程语言开始,可以先从基础的HTML和CSS学起。即使你并不打算成为一名全职开发者,但这些基础技能也能让你在日常的SEO工作中更加得心应手。</p><h3>4.SEO技术性工作中常用的编程知识</h3><p>如果你已经是一个SEO从业者,或者正在考虑转型为SEO专家,那么理解一些技术性工作中的编程知识将是一个不错的选择。以下是一些SEO技术性工作中常用的编程知识。</p><h3>HTML与CSS</h3><p>HTML(超文本标记语言)是网页的基本构建块,它定义了网页的结构。而CSS(层叠样式表)则用来控制网页的样式和布局。对于SEO来说,理解HTML和CSS非常重要,因为很多优化措施都涉及到这些基础的标记语言。</p><p>例如,合理的使用HTML标签(如<h1>至<h6>)能够帮助搜索引擎更好地理解页面结构,提高页面的可读性。了解CSS优化网页布局、调整字体和图像大小、确保响应式设计等,都有助于提升用户体验和SEO效果。</p><h3>JavaScript</h3><p>JavaScript是一种编程语言,广泛用于网页的动态效果和交互设计。虽然JavaScript对于网站的动态内容展示非常重要,但它也可能对SEO产生一定影响。许多现代网站依赖JavaScript来加载内容,如果JavaScript没有正确加载,可能会导致搜索引擎无法完全抓取和索引这些内容。</p><p>因此,SEO从业者了解一些JavaScript的基本原理,能够帮助你识别和修复与JavaScript相关的SEO问题。比如,如何确保网页内容在JavaScript加载后能够被搜索引擎正确抓取,或者如何使用服务器端渲染(SSR)来优化页面的加载速度。</p><h3>服务器配置与优化</h3><p>网站的服务器配置直接影响到页面的加载速度和稳定性。一些高级的SEO技术工作,往往需要了解服务器配置,如如何设置301重定向、如何使用HTTP压缩等。虽然这些工作不完全属于前端开发,但一些基础的服务器操作和配置知识,能够让你更好地优化网站的性能。</p><h3>5.实践中如何学习和运用代码</h3><p>如果你决定开始学习SEO中的编程知识,最好的方法就是从实际操作中积累经验。以下是几种学习方式:</p><h3>1.在线教程和课程</h3><p>现在有很多免费的在线资源和付费课程可以帮助你快速入门SEO中的编程知识。例如,W3Schools、MDNWebDocs等网站提供了免费的HTML、CSS、JavaScript等教程,适合SEO从业者自学。</p><h3>2.参加SEO和开发者社区</h3><p>参与一些SEO或开发者社区,向有经验的人请教,不仅可以帮助你解决实际问题,还能够了解一些行业的最新动态。</p><h3>3.通过实践和项目积累经验</h3><p>最有效的学习方式是通过实践。你可以自己建立一个网站或博客,并尝试应用所学的编程知识来进行SEO优化。通过不断的实验和调整,你会发现自己逐渐能够解决更多的SEO技术问题。</p><h3>6.结语:学会代码,让SEO更具竞争力</h3><p>做SEO并不一定需要精通代码,但学一些基础的编程知识无疑可以提升你的SEO工作效率。无论是技术性SEO的优化,还是内容性SEO的细节调整,懂得一定的代码都会让你在竞争中更具优势。如果你正在从事SEO工作,不妨开始学习一些基础的编程知识,让自己成为一个更全面的SEO专家。</p>
标签:
#SEO
#学代码
#SEO与编程
#搜索引擎优化
#SEO技巧
#SEO入门
#SEO
#学代码
#SEO与编程
#搜索引擎优化
#SEO技巧
#SEO入门
相关文章:
做SEO的职业发展:未来互联网行业的黄金机会
株洲获客网络推广SEO:助力企业抢占市场先机
详细介绍附子SEO资源,优化步骤与实战方法,太仓企业网站优化
企业上网究竟为了啥?--说说电子商务与网络营销
SEO站长优化工具提升网站排名的必备法宝
免费的GPT用的是什么?揭秘背后的技术和平台
日付网赚联盟:日付cpa广告联盟的盈利模式和变现过程
网站宝快速排名:让您的网站轻松登顶,抢占搜索引擎流量高地
网页测试的未来趋势如何选择适合的工具与方法提升网站质量
小旋风泛目录:重新定义数字营销时代的内容管理与推广
全国SEO优化步骤,关键词布局的艺术与方法,关键词权重决定排名
ChatGPT知乎免费:打破知识壁垒,开启智能时代的新篇章
SEO短视频网页入口引流网址的绝佳选择,助力流量爆发!
ZBlog放置公安备案,提升网站安全合规性,快速提升用户信任
专业关键词优化:让您的网站在搜索引擎中脱颖而出
网站克隆模板:助力企业轻松打造高效网站的利器
微商控价系统有什么作用
有帮助。它可以帮助你克服收录的困难,让你的网站文章再次被百度收录并推广出去
AI小说写作在线:赋能创作,打造未来文学新篇章
国产品牌【韩束】史上最大品牌升级,要红?
做SEO项目分析:提升网站排名的关键策略
重庆永川效果好的SEO优化,助力企业实现精准营销
做SEO排名有名,助力企业站点高效引流与精准转化
SEO优化代优化:让您的网站轻松登顶搜索引擎
AI摘要生成:提升工作效率的新神器
穿“香菜比基尼”带货,白象直播太炸裂了!
淘宝批量发货怎么操作?批量发货有什么技巧?
新产品的推广方式都有什么?
网站排名是指什么?揭秘网站排名背后的秘密
让数据为你服务“爬取”技术的无限潜力
AI写作指令词条大全写作的无限可能
免费爆文采集平台,让你轻松获得优质内容!
企业职位SEO是什么意思?揭秘搜索引擎优化的职业前景与发展
利用AI文字生成技术,开创内容创作新时代
什么是CHATGPT?带你了解人工智能的未来
塘沽SEO优化咨询电话高效网络营销的方法,如何查直通车关键词排名
对保险网络营销的正确认识
重庆SEO招商加盟条件助力企业腾飞的绝佳选择
冰糖故事会!小说推文新玩法,更简单更直接,转化更高!
怎样规划网站才会引来流量?网站推广小揭秘
如何提高网页点击率:10大策略助你流量激增
提升企业网络影响力的关键:四平网站优化
网站快速提高排名的秘诀,轻松超越竞争对手
AI写作生成器免费网站大全,让你轻松生成优质文章!
高效实现文件批量下载,轻松应对海量URL下载任务
做SEO能挣钱吗?揭秘SEO赚钱的潜力与机会
网络营销应从“点”谈起
重庆SEO优化:助力企业在竞争激烈的市场中脱颖而出
ChatGPT网页版无法翻页?这样解决问题,提升使用体验!
详细介绍化州SEO技术,优化步骤与实战方法,淄博网络seo技巧
相关栏目:
【关于我们5】
【广告策划】
【案例欣赏33】
【新闻中心38088】
【AI推广17915】
【联系我们1】